UCS2D680MHD Equivalent & Substitute Parts
Part Overview
The UCS2D680MHD is a 68 µF, 200 V aluminum electrolytic capacitor in radial, can package manufactured by Nichicon. This component is rated for 10000 hours at 105°C and is designed for general purpose applications requiring through-hole mounting. The part is currently active in production with ROHS3 compliance and REACH unaffected status. Engineering Selection Recommendations
Both the UCS2D680MHD and UCY2D680MHD3 are active production parts from Nichicon with identical ROHS3 compliance and REACH unaffected status. The UCY2D680MHD3 provides extended operational lifetime (12000 hours versus 10000 hours at 105°C) and a reduced maximum seated height, making it suitable for applications with space constraints or requiring enhanced reliability margins. Both parts maintain identical electrical performance across all specified ripple current ratings and operating temperature ranges. Selection between these parts depends on application-specific requirements for component longevity and physical space availability on the printed circuit board.
